SAME-SEX HARASSMENT: SAME AS OPPOSITE-SEX HARASSMENT

In a recent case, Plaintiff was an intern at a water treatment plant. Defendant, Plaintiff’s supervisor, showed him pornographic images on his computer. Defendant also told Plaintiff vulgar sexual jokes. Defendant also suggested that Plaintiff visit his home and once said, “Why don’t you just kiss me?” Defendant claimed that the joke telling and computer images were “mere banter among male co-workers.”

The court found that sexual harassment can occur between members of the same gender as long as the employee can show that he was harassed “because of sex” or was exposed to disadvantageous conditions to which employees of the other sex weren’t exposed.

Courts have recognized many situations that show same-gender harassment is discrimination “because of sex.” Explicit or implicit proposals of sexual activity between same-sex employees are sufficient proof of harassment if there is credible evidence that the harasser is seeking a same-sex relationship. However, harassing conduct doesn’t necessarily have to be motivated by sexual desire. Sexual comments intended to humiliate an employee and challenge his sexual identity can be sufficient to show unlawful harassment because of sex.

In this case, Plaintiff presented enough evidence to support an inference that Defendant was motivated by sexual interest.

BOTTOM LINE: Same-gender sexual harassment claims are just as dangerous as claims filed by opposite-sex employees. An employee need not necessarily object at the time of the offensive conduct to later pursue a claim, so you must make certain that everyone in the workforce is trained on the do’s and don’ts of proper workplace conduct and not wait until an employee complains to be proactive.
